[Music] according to data from Gallup only 32% of employees in the US are engaged their data shows that 51% of employees are unengaged and 17% are actively disengaged actively disengaged employees are estimated to cost about five hundred billion dollars per year in lost productivity this calls for close monitoring of employee morale and the general work environment and that's where an employee engagement survey can help employee engagement is the extent to which employees feel valued and involved in their everyday work an employee engagement survey is the measure of each employee's involvement within the company here are some tips for creating great employee engagement surveys keep your employee engagement survey short and to the point keep your questions focused and directly relevant to the employees taking the survey ideally it should not take the employees more than 10 minutes to complete the survey conduct a simple employee NPS survey if you're only looking to gauge the pulse of y...
